Heyfield Skatepark is a small and vibrant skateboarding facility located in Heyfield, a town in West & South Gippsland, Victoria. This concrete skateboard park features a unique kidney-shaped bowl that is 1. 8 metres deep, providing skaters with an exhilarating experience. The bowl is equipped with metal coping, enhancing the park's durability and providing a smooth ride for skateboard enthusiasts.
At one end of the skatepark, riders will find a flat bank with three stairs and a central rail, adding versatility and challenges to their tricks and manoeuvres. Additionally, there is a bank with a curved ledge, giving skaters the opportunity to showcase their skills in a creative and technical manner.

For those looking to take a break from skating or to observe the action, there is a sheltered area with comfortable seating available. This allows visitors to relax and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ere of the skatepark while interacting with fellow skaters and enthusiasts.
Heyfield Skatepark is conveniently located at Apex Park on George Street, ensuring easy access for both locals and travellers passing through the area. Its central position within Heyfield makes it a hub for skateboarders, fostering a sense of community and camaraderie among riders.
